Transaction d1634d265f688793d181505393d70a138ffdf90e83c25b1825fa3028f14e4ee8
1 Input
1 Output
-
d1634d265f688793d181505393d70a138ffdf90e83c25b1825fa3028f14e4ee8:0
- value
- 822870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50dd555f38cde79c389a7ad8d78c9058ee51c766 OP_EQUAL
- address
- 394b8QkRA2wA3AyBogaee8Gh9i5KHBgkHK